WebUse the following example as a guide for required actions in an emergency: Declare an emergency. Alert personnel using an internal communication system (see step #6). Activate the emergency plan. Evacuate the danger zone, seek shelter-in-place or implement a lock down. Close main shutoffs, if applicable. WebTo prepare for a tornado, businesses should develop an emergency plan. WebNov 11, 2024 · Develop the outline and guidelines of your business emergency plan. Assess risks and threats to your business. Conduct a business impact analysis. Write your business emergency plan. Review and test your plan. Identify areas of improvement and refine your plan. Work through your business recovery strategies. ozito impact wrench

Being prepared for an emergency or disaster can: save lives and prevent harm. help businesses to continue trading through hardship. give staff and owners confidence. protect equipment and premises.

WebMar 28, 2024 · 3. Review your emergency management plan. Regularly review your emergency management and recovery plan. It's also important to update your plan each time your staff change, or if you move to a new business location. Practice your emergency action plan with your staff.
